Definitions of “prove”
To demonstrate that something is true or viable; to give proof for; to bear out; to testify.
“[VV]e are able with playne demonſtration to proue, and vvith reaſon to perſvvade that in tymes paſt our fayth vvas alike, that then vve preached thinges correſpondent vnto the forme of faith already published of vs, ſo that none in this behalfe can repyne or gaynesay vs.”
To turn out; to manifest.
“It proved to be a cold day.”
The process of dough proofing.
“You may also need to think about what the prove is doing to the loaf of bread — it is warming the dough and making it moist, allowing it to rise […]”
